Signing Math and Science
What it is: Signing Math & Science uses SigningAvatar® assistive technology to develop illustrated, interactive 3D standards-based sign language dictionaries that offer students ingrades K-8 and 9-12who are deaf and hard of hearing increased access to the same learning opportunities that hearing students enjoy.

Fun STEM Fact!
Around 400 BC, the ancient Greek inventor Archytas of Tarentum built an early "robot" — a wooden pigeon that flew through the air on a steam-powered arm.
